A bill to move toward energy independence through a coordinated development of renewable energy sources, including wave, solar, wind, geothermal, and biofuels production. 3/28/2007--Introduced. Creating Renewable Energy through Science and Technology Act, or the CREST Act - Amends the National Science Foundation Act of 1950 to instruct the Director of the National Science Foundation to establish the Council on Renewable Energy (CORE) to: (1) advise Congress on renewable energy development, strategy, research, and marketability; and (2) facilitate collaboration among federal agencies regarding the execution of national renewable energy objectives.
